Is it possible to fly with only one engine?
Can You Fly with Only One Engine?
When it comes to aircraft, the question of whether it’s possible to fly with only one engine often arises. The answer depends on the type of aircraft in question.
Single-Engine Aircraft
Single-engine aircraft, as the name suggests, have only one engine. These aircraft are designed to operate safely on a single functional engine until fuel depletion. In the event of an engine failure, the pilot must follow emergency procedures to maintain control and land the aircraft safely.
Single-engine aircraft are typically lighter and more economical than multi-engine aircraft. They are often used for private flying, flight training, and short-distance commercial flights.
Twin-Engine Aircraft
Twin-engine aircraft, on the other hand, are equipped with two engines. These aircraft are designed to operate on both engines, but they can also fly safely on a single engine. However, in the event of an engine failure, twin-engine aircraft are mandated to land at the nearest suitable airport, regardless of fuel supply.
This regulation is in place for safety reasons. Twin-engine aircraft are typically heavier and require more power to fly than single-engine aircraft. If an engine fails, the remaining engine may not be able to generate enough power to maintain altitude indefinitely.
Additionally, twin-engine aircraft are often used for longer-distance flights and may carry more passengers and cargo. A forced landing far from an airport could pose a significant safety risk.
